MySQL Workbench is a database -Modellierungswerkzeug, the database design , modeling, creating and editing (maintenance) of MySQL databases in a surrounding area integrated. It is the successor of the now discontinued DBDesigner 4 from FabForce, Workbench can import the XML models from DBDesigner and should run on every X Window System as well as under MS Windows.
The first beta version was available from November 19, 2007. The version number of the current versions is only adapted to the current beta version number of MySQL itself. MySQL Workbench is offered both as a “Community Edition” under the GPL and with additional functionality as a “Standard Edition” commercially in the form of an annual subscription.
